- This invention relates to the electrical connector art and, more particularly, to an assembly for connecting two different flat cables.

- An electrical fusing arrangement comprising a first member formed of an electrically insulating material to which may be secured the ends of two fiat cables with the conductive tracks on one of said cables being aligned with the conductive tracks on the other of said cables, a second generally flat member of insulating material having on at least one of its faces electrically conductive fuse tracks each having a reduced width region functioning as a fuse, said fuse tracks extending in parallel relationship between opposite sides of said second member and being electrically isolated from each other, said second member being fitted to said first member such that each of said fuse tracks bridges the gap between the conductive tracks on said flat cables, and latch means for rapidly, releasably fastening said first and said second members together.
- said first member has a fiat rectangular surface with an upstanding pillar at each corner, each said pillar having a 4 slot at its base where it meets said flat surface, and said flat cables being adapted to be each secured to said first member by having their edges held in said slots.
- said second member is a board of insulating material carry.- ing said fuse tracks supported by a backing strip, and said second member is formed with hook-ended latches at two opposed edges thereof normal to said opposite sides and forming said latch means, said hook-ended latches, when said second member is positioned on said first member, each passing between two of said pillars and engaging the surface of said first member opposite to said flat rectangular surface.
- An arrangement as recited in claim 1 including spring means on said first member for urging said flat cable ends on said first member into engagement with said fuse tracks.
- said first member is channel shaped providing a pair of side walls each adapted to have a flat cable extending thereover, and said second member has curved sides over which said fuse tracks extend, said second member being insertable into said channel.
